Enjoy skyline/city views from this 17th floor flat
The apartment is located on the 17th floor of an iconic building designed by an acclaimed Mexican architect and on the most iconic avenue in Mexico City, Paseos de la Reforma, just a few blocks away from the beautiful monument a la Revolucion.
Here you'll enjoy the mesmerizing view from the balcony while having a cup of coffee in the morning.
Close to Condesa, Roma, Polanco, and the historic center, this is the perfect place to explore the city while feeling at home.
An apartment with an incredible architectural design and a carefully selected interior design resulting in a perfect mix of comfy, cozy, and elegant.
An incredible space outfitted with two bedrooms, two full bathrooms, a common area where you'll find the dining and living area, and a fully equipped kitchen with everything you need to prepare a quick breakfast or a more complicated meal.
The apartment has high-speed WI-FI, 3 Smart TVs, a safe, black-outs and electronic translucent curtains, and a washer-dryer. Security personnel during the day and night, as well as smart locks for secure access. Additional parking space can be requested at no extra cost.
